I decided to post a few pics, and make a TR out of it. I know Alex will ring in with more pics (please).
"The Tunnel" on the way to Big Horn
The first rap in Big Horn - a gradual walk-down that gets steeper and steeper, eventually ending in this overhanging lip
The final rap out of Big Horn - approx 55 feet of free air!
